Transaction

0c75613ecc4f524bdf6bf4d4897d8d90fe5f65a2bf232ea55c05bf09e6dc552a
658,347 confirmations
Timestamp
1387583651
Block276,123
Fee4,100,000 sats
Fee rate50.4 sats/vB
view on mempool.space

Inputs & Outputs

Inputs